Steps to reproduce:

1. Plug headphones into the phone.
2. Visit http://mozilla.github.com/webrtc-landing/gum_test.html
3. Select Audio.
4. Select "Share" to share microphone with Nightly.


Actual results:

The sound was coming out of the built-in speaker of the phone.


Expected results:

The sound should come out from the headphones instead.
The phone I used was:

Samsung Galaxy SII, AT&T Skyrocket (SAMSUNG-SGH-I727)
Android 4.1.2, Cyanogenmod 10.0.0-skyrocket

I was able to get sound to come out of the headphones instead of the built-in speaker by unplugging the headphones and replugging them into the phone.

I don't think this related to WebRTC. We don't do anything with altering the output of volume on headphones vs. speaker. This is likely either a bug at the Android stack layer or a problem with your headphones. As such, I'm closing this as invalid, as this is not a bug targeted in this bug tracker.
